Los Angeles Rams standout Puka Nacua might be gearing up to sue his recent accuser. As previously reported by The Blast, Nacua was accused of using antisemitic language and crossing a Los Angeles woman’s personal boundaries in a temporary restraining order request that was filed. A new report states that not only is Nacua denying the allegations, but the BYU alum is also planning to sue the woman for defamation.

According to TMZ, Nacua is considering taking legal action against a California woman who leveled horrifying allegations against him.

In her temporary restraining order filing, the woman claimed Nacua screamed “f-ck all the Jews” during a night out before allegedly biting her so hard that he broke her skin.

Nacua’s lawyer denied the initial allegations, calling her filing nothing more than a shakedown. In a new statement, Nacua’s team maintained its position, saying, “Puka denies these allegations in the strongest possible terms.”

“We will be filing a defamation lawsuit and pursuing all available legal remedies in response to these false and damaging statements,” Nacua’s lawyer, Levi McCathern, added.

The allegations against Nacua couldn’t come at a more unfortunate time, considering the NFL superstar sparked backlash in December 2025 after he was seen mimicking an antisemitic gesture during a livestream with Adin Ross.

“When I appeared the other day on a social media livestream, it was suggested to me to perform a specific movement as part of my next touchdown celebration,” he said in a since-deleted apology. “At the time, I had no idea this act was antisemitic in nature and perpetuated harmful stereotypes against Jewish people,” he added.

“I do not stand for any form of racism, bigotry, or hate of another group of people,” he continued.

Also, during that livestream, Nacua called out the NFL referees, claiming they make certain calls not because they’re right, but because they want to be seen on TV. “You don’t think [an official] is texting his friends in the group chat, like, ‘Yo, you guys just saw me on ‘Sunday Night Football’? That wasn’t [pass interference], but I called it,'” Nacua said.

The league fined him $25,000 for his comments.

McCarthen stated to TMZ, maintaining Nacua’s innocence amid the recent allegations. He also slammed the Los Angeles accuser for allegedly seeking a massive payday, saying, “This is not a legitimate legal claim; it is blackmail.”

“The timing of the claimant’s recent legal action — nearly three months after the alleged incident and just says after JSN’s record-breaking contract as a wide receiver — further underscores the complete lack of credibility behind these accusations,” McCarthen added.

McCarthen didn’t stop there, though. He actually echoed those sentiments in a statement to USA Today, in which he said the case against Nacua “is not sexual in nature” and it doesn’t “involve any allegation of domestic violence.”
